The Town of Hudson is a home rule municipality<ref>Template:Cite web</ref> in Weld County, Colorado, United States. The population was 1,651 at the 2020 census.<ref name="Census 2020" />

A post office called Hudson has been in operation since 1883.<ref>Template:Cite web</ref> The town derives its name from the town company, Hudson City Land and Improvement Co.<ref>Template:Cite book</ref>
